This is not the only difference between Mulan’s animated and live-action incantations. The movie will also be without Mushu, the dragon spirit voiced by Eddie Murphy in the animated version. According to director Niki Caro, both have been excised from the live-action version to try and tell a more realistic version of the legend than the primary-colored Disney version – a version created by a white, non-Asian team. She told People: “Mushu, beloved as that character is in the animation, was Mulan’s confidante, and part of bringing it into the live-action is to commit to the realism of her journey, and she had to make those relationships with her fellow soldiers....
